About the Spokane River Centennial Trail trail
Set in Northeast Washington, Spokane River Centennial Trail is a point-to-point route of 14.5 miles. Expect 292 feet of climbing between 1,922 feet and 2,066 feet. The steepest pitch reaches 6 percent, against an average of 20 feet of gain per mile. On our gain-and-distance scale it falls in the moderate band. The nearest town is Spokane Valley, about 1.9 miles away.
The trail
The Spokane River Centennial Trail is a 39-mile (63 km) paved trail in Eastern Washington for alternate transportation and recreational use. It is managed by Washington State Parks as the Centennial Trail State Park.
